How in the hell does "Dr. Z" still have a job? That guy is wrong on his predictions 97% of the time!
That's because he usually only picks the tough games and doesn't bother to pick games like, for example, Colts over Cardinals.The guy still has a job because he is one of the very, very few columnists that actually watches tape and breaks it down, instead of just making assumptions, buying into hype, and drawing conclusions based on statistics and popular media opinion. He tapes the games, watches them, re-watches them, and fills up notebook after notebook with his observations and analyses. In a world of Pete Priscos, Skip Baylesses, and Ron Borgeses, Zimmerman is a columnist that knows what he's talking about because he actually takes the time to watch the games and form his own intelligent opinions.His books "The Thinking Man's Guide to Pro Football" and his 1984 update of that book, "The New Thinking Man's Guide to Pro Football" are widely considered the best analytical books ever written about the game.If Zimmerman were fired from SI today, he'd have every other media outlet in the country banging on his door with offers within minutes.That's how he still has a job.
